About Grantsboro, NC

Grantsboro is a city in North Carolina, located in Pamlico County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 2,074 residents. It is a mature city, with a median age of 49.5 years.

Economically, Grantsboro is a solidly middle-class community. The median household income of $67,077 is near the national average. Approximately 10.4%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 3.1%, below the national average.

The real estate market in Grantsboro is one of the more affordable housing markets in the country. Median home values stand at $138,100, which is well below the national average. Renters typically pay around $751 per month. Homeownership is high at 78.1%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Grantsboro is moderately educated. 36.7%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— near the national average. The community is primarily White (83.56%).

Grantsboro, NC offers residents a cost-conscious lifestyle within North Carolina.
